Which of the following are measures taken in Guinea worm prophylaxis, EXCEPT:

Correct Answer: Mass treatment with Mebendazole
Description: Drugs are not suitable for mass treatment. The worms have to be removed manually. There is no known curative medicine or vaccine to prevent Guinea worm disease. The best way to stop Guinea worm disease is to prevent people from entering sources of drinking water with an active infection and to educate households to always use cloth filters to sieve out tiny water fleas carrying infective larvae. Educating communities about Guinea worm prevention is vital to stopping the spread of the disease. Guinea worm disease is set to become the second human disease in history, after smallpox, to be eradicated. It will be the first parasitic disease to be eradicated and the first disease to be eradicated without the use of a vaccine or medical treatment.
